It's time to level up your lighting game, and there's no better solution than the slick and beautifully designed Twinkly "Dots" Flexible Smart LED String Light. Whether you opt for the 60 LED 10 foot, the 200 LED 33 foot, or the 400 LED 66 foot light, it offers simple installation, easy pairing with the Twinkly app, and tons of control to add a rainbow of color to any room, office, den, computer room, or dorm.
